MCDConsumer Discretionary

McDonald's is a Dividend Aristocrat with 48+ consecutive years of increases. As the world's most visited fast food brand with 40,000+ locations, its franchise model generates high-margin royalties. MCD's real estate holdings (owning land under many franchised locations) create an additional asset floor supporting long-term value.
